This ancient gold stater originates from the legendary era of Alexander the Great, who ruled the Kingdom of Macedonia from 336 to 323 BC. Weighing approximately 8.5 grams, the coin represents the high artistry and economic reach of the ancient Greek world during a period of vast imperial expansion. The obverse of the coin displays the profile of Athena, the goddess of wisdom and warfare, depicted wearing an ornate helmet. On the reverse, the winged goddess of victory, Nike, is captured in a graceful pose, symbolizing the triumphs of the Macedonian state. This specific gold piece has survived more than two millennia in an exceptional state of preservation. It has been certified as Choice Almost Uncirculated, with assessors awarding it a perfect five out of five rating for its strike quality, and a four out of five rating for its surface preservation.
